如何突破蓝牙耳机桌面控制限制?Galaxy Buds Manager的跨平台创新实践

如何突破蓝牙耳机桌面控制限制?Galaxy Buds Manager的跨平台创新实践 如何突破蓝牙耳机桌面控制限制Galaxy Buds Manager的跨平台创新实践【免费下载链接】GalaxyBudsClientUnofficial Galaxy Buds Manager for Windows, macOS, and Linux项目地址: https://gitcode.com/gh_mirrors/gal/GalaxyBudsClient当你在电脑前专注工作时想要调节Galaxy Buds的降噪模式却不得不拿起手机当你需要精确了解耳机剩余电量时系统托盘只能显示模糊的电量图标当你想自定义触摸操作时却发现电脑端根本没有设置界面——这些痛点是否也曾困扰过你Galaxy Buds Manager作为一款开源的跨平台管理工具通过逆向工程蓝牙RFCOMM协议一种用于蓝牙设备间串行通信的协议成功实现了对Galaxy Buds系列耳机的全面控制让桌面端耳机管理体验不再妥协。1. 核心应用场景解析Galaxy Buds Manager并非简单的功能集合而是针对不同用户群体的场景化解决方案技术爱好者的探索工具对于喜欢深入了解设备工作原理的你可以通过软件内置的开发者模式实时监控蓝牙通信数据包分析耳机与设备间的交互逻辑。有用户通过该功能成功发现了隐藏的均衡器参数调节接口解锁了官方应用未开放的音效自定义选项。专业工作者的效率助手远程会议频繁的职场人士可通过快捷键快速切换降噪模式——在嘈杂环境中开启深度降噪专注会议需要临时交流时一键切换至环境音模式无需中断会议流程。某软件开发团队反馈这一功能使团队线上会议效率提升了23%。多设备用户的统一管理中心同时使用Windows电脑和MacBook的用户无需在不同平台切换设置Galaxy Buds Manager提供一致的操作体验所有个性化设置自动同步实现无缝跨设备使用。2. 问题根源与解决方案2.1 传统桌面蓝牙管理的三大痛点想象这样一个场景你正在赶制一份重要报告戴着Galaxy Buds Pro听着专注音乐突然需要与同事短暂交流。此时你不得不暂停音乐拿出手机打开Galaxy Wearable应用切换到环境音模式再回到电脑前——整个过程中断了你的工作流。这正是传统桌面蓝牙管理的典型痛点功能割裂官方应用生态闭环严重移动端功能丰富而桌面端被严重简化形成设备功能断层。大多数用户不知道的是Galaxy Buds系列耳机通过蓝牙协议提供了远超系统默认支持的控制能力只是这些能力被限制在官方移动应用中。数据盲区系统级蓝牙管理只能提供基础连接状态无法获取耳机和充电盒的精确电量、温度、电压等关键数据。这导致用户经常遭遇电量突然耗尽的尴尬情况特别是在长途旅行或重要会议等关键场景。交互局限耳机的物理按键或触摸区域功能固定无法根据桌面使用场景自定义。例如默认的双击操作在电脑端可能更适合映射为播放/暂停而非唤醒语音助手。2.2 Galaxy Buds Manager的突破路径面对这些挑战Galaxy Buds Manager采取了三大创新策略协议逆向工程开发团队通过分析蓝牙通信流量成功破解了Galaxy Buds系列的私有通信协议实现了与官方应用同等的控制深度。这一过程涉及数百小时的数据包捕获与解析最终构建了完整的命令映射表。跨平台抽象层针对Windows、macOS和Linux不同的蓝牙栈实现设计了统一的抽象接口确保核心功能在各平台上表现一致。特别针对Linux系统的BlueZ协议栈进行了深度优化解决了设备发现和连接稳定性问题。模块化架构设计采用MVVMModel-View-ViewModel架构将设备通信、数据处理和UI展示清晰分离使功能扩展和维护变得简单。这一设计使得社区贡献者能够轻松添加对新耳机型号的支持。3. 核心功能与使用价值3.1 全方位设备监控中心用户价值告别电量焦虑实现对耳机状态的全面掌控。实现方式通过持续监听耳机广播的状态数据包实时更新电量、电压、温度等参数。软件采用直观的可视化界面将左右耳机和充电盒的电量以百分比精确显示并通过颜色编码标识不同状态——绿色表示电量充足黄色提醒注意充电红色则警告电量紧急。使用场景程序员小李在连续编码两小时后通过软件注意到右耳机电量已低于20%及时将其放入充电盒避免了会议中突然断电的尴尬。温度监测功能还帮助他发现了长时间使用后耳机温度略高的问题及时调整了佩戴方式。3.2 个性化音频体验调节用户价值根据不同场景定制专属音效提升听感体验。实现方式通过向耳机发送特定的控制指令实现均衡器参数调节、环境音强度控制和降噪模式切换。软件内置了多种预设音效同时支持自定义频段调节满足不同音乐类型和个人偏好。使用场景设计师小王在处理音频素材时通过软件快速切换至工作室预设增强中频细节休闲听歌时则切换到低音增强模式享受更沉浸的音乐体验。环境音模式的无级调节让他在不摘下耳机的情况下能够清晰听到同事的交流。3.3 触摸交互自定义系统用户价值将耳机触摸区域变成可定制的快捷控制面板。实现方式通过修改耳机固件中的配置参数重新定义触摸操作的功能映射。支持双击、长按、滑动等多种手势可映射为播放控制、音量调节、降噪切换等常用功能。使用场景视频编辑师小张将左耳双击设置为上一曲右耳双击设置为下一曲长按任一耳机切换降噪模式使他在时间线编辑过程中无需分心操作键盘只需轻触耳机即可完成媒体控制。4. 安装部署指南4.1 准备工作在开始安装前请确保你的系统满足以下条件Windows 10/11、macOS 10.15或主流Linux发行版如Ubuntu 20.04已安装Git和.NET 6.0 SDK耳机已通过系统蓝牙正常配对4.2 执行安装步骤▶️ 获取项目源码git clone https://gitcode.com/gh_mirrors/gal/GalaxyBudsClient▶️ 进入项目目录并构建cd GalaxyBudsClient dotnet build GalaxyBudsClient.sln -c Release▶️ 运行应用程序cd GalaxyBudsClient/bin/Release/net6.0 ./GalaxyBudsClient4.3 验证安装结果启动应用后你应该能看到以下验证标志软件主界面成功显示左侧导航栏包含降噪控制、均衡器等选项已连接的Galaxy Buds设备名称出现在界面顶部耳机和充电盒的电量状态正确显示如果遇到连接问题请检查蓝牙服务是否正常运行或尝试重新配对设备。5. 项目发展前景展望Galaxy Buds Manager作为开源项目其未来发展充满潜力。随着社区的不断壮大我们有理由期待设备支持扩展目前项目已支持Galaxy Buds系列多款型号未来有望扩展到其他品牌的蓝牙音频设备打破品牌壁垒成为通用的耳机管理平台。AI增强功能通过分析用户使用习惯智能推荐音效设置和触摸操作配置实现千人千面的个性化体验。例如系统可根据你常听的音乐类型自动调整均衡器参数。云同步服务实现用户配置的云端备份与同步让你在更换设备时无需重新设置保持一致的使用体验。生态系统整合与主流桌面操作系统的通知中心、语音助手深度集成实现更自然的交互方式如通过语音命令调节耳机设置。Galaxy Buds Manager的成功证明了开源社区的创新力量。通过逆向工程和协议解析原本封闭的硬件功能被重新赋能为用户带来了真正有价值的解决方案。对于你——无论是普通用户还是开发者——这都是一个难得的机会参与到硬件民主化的进程中共同打造更开放、更可控的数字生活体验。【免费下载链接】GalaxyBudsClientUnofficial Galaxy Buds Manager for Windows, macOS, and Linux项目地址: https://gitcode.com/gh_mirrors/gal/GalaxyBudsClient创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考